Congressional leaders advance the President’s spending plans on Wednesday.Wired PR News – Democrats in Congress have reportedly progressed budget outlines that resemble President Barack Obama’s tax and spending plans. As reported by the Associated Press (AP), Congressional leaders advanced the measure on Wednesday with changes that considered growing concerns over the expanding deficit. Senate Majority Leader Harry Reid is quoted as stating of the outline, “This budget will protect President Obama’s priorities — education, energy, health care, middle class tax relief and cut the deficit in half.”Obama met with Democrat leaders on Wednesday at the Capitol. Kent Conrad, Budget Committee Chairman, is quoted as stating of the visit, “He came here to show leadership and to show we’re together on his priorities.”Obama is quoted as stating in a news conference held the day before the advancement of the budget outlines, “The best way to bring our deficit down in the long run is … with a budget that leads to broad economic growth by moving from an era of borrow and spend to one where we save and invest.”
